Wireguard is a VPN alternative that is under development. Yet it is faster and carefully designed when compared to other similar products.
In essence, every VPN has to strengthen WireGuard’s wobbly privacy to benefit from its speed and security. That’s why we recommend using WireGuard-based protocols only if they come from reputable VPN providers....
WireGuard was not designed to obfuscate user traffic to this degree, and only supports UDP. This means that a simple, standalone WireGuard connection is easy to detect. However, as WireGuard is so extensible, most VPN...
